Course comparison

The table summarises the currently matched options. Compare the available dates, duration and fees, then check the course page for full details.

CourseProviderAgesDatesDurationFees
Faculty of Law at Oxford CollegeSummer Boarding Courses15-17June - August 20272 Weeks£6,695.00
Law & Politics (Oxford)Oxford Royale16-18Check course2 weeks£6,995
Explore Law (Oxford)Oxford Royale12-15Check course2 weeks£6,995
Law in Oxford for Ages 16-18Immerse Education16-18June - August 20272+ weeks£7,495
International Relations in Oxford for Ages 16-18Immerse Education16-18June - August 20272+ weeks£7,495
Law in Oxford for Ages 13-15Immerse Education13-15June - August 20272+ weeks£7,495
Law (The Oxford Tradition)Oxbridge Academic Programs16 -18June - August 20272 or 4 weeks$7,395 for one session; $12,595 for combined session
Law (The Oxford Summer Seminar)Oxbridge Academic Programs16 -18June - August 20271 or 2 weeks$3,995 for one session; $7,395 for the combined session

How to choose

When comparing law in Oxford for ages 13-18, start with fit rather than headline. A strong option should make the teaching level, practical work, dates, fees and provider responsibilities clear before you apply.

Academic level

Check whether the law course is introductory, advanced or designed for students with prior study. Age eligibility does not always tell you the academic level by itself.

Course focus

Look for a clear description of what students will study, practise or produce. Similar course titles can cover quite different project work, teaching styles or specialisms.

Dates, duration and fees

Use the table to compare timing and cost, then confirm the latest inclusions with the provider before applying.
